Template:Category by date navbox

From Wikimedia Commons, the free media repository
Jump to navigation Jump to search
History of [[{{{subject}}}]]
Centuries: 8th9th10th14th15th16th17th18th19th20th21st
Decades:
Years: 0123456789
Template documentationview · edit · history · purge ]


Warning PLEASE DO NOT USE CURRENTLY. Currently in beta test state. Only in use in a few selected categories.


This template is for using on time-categories for places / events, especially for cities. So, that an overview for the place / event of centuries and years is possible. Because of changing the millennium, century and millennium are fix. Otherwise you should need to be a millennium-category only for the 2000s and 2010s (at this time) with many red-links.


Examples

[edit]
  • See at Category:2009 in Quedlinburg (withprevious/next year arrows” shown since it is a category by year).
  • Or see the following example for the "Frankfurt am Main 1990" decade category (withoutprevious/next year arrows” shown since it is not a category by year):
Frankfurt (Main) by time
Centuries: 8th9th10th14th15th16th17th18th19th20th21st
Decades: 1900s1910s1920s1930s1940s1950s1960s1970s1980s1990s
Years: 1990199119921993199419951996199719981999

How To

[edit]
  • title = Title of the infobox
  • image = Name of an coat of arms / logo, without "File:" and without brackets
  • m = Millenium
  • c = Century / Jahrhundert
  • d = Decade / Jahrzehnt
  • y = Year / Jahr
  • c-pre = Prefix of century category names / Präfix vor Kategorienamen von Jahrhunderten
  • d-pre = Prefix of decade category names / Präfix vor Kategorienamen von Jahrzehnten
  • y-suf = Suffix of year category names / Suffix hinter dem Jahr im Kategoriename

If you use it in a

  • decade category use y = 0,
  • century category use d and y = 0.

Copy&Paste

[edit]
{{Category by date navbox
|title = 
|image = 
|m = 
|c = 
|d = 
|y = 
|c-pre = 
|c-suf =
|d-pre =
|d-suf =
|y-pre 
|y-suf = 
}}

To-Do

[edit]
  • non-existing categories should not visible ✓ Done
  • Handling if no image is given / needed ✓ Done
  • Parameter image sollte einfach die komplette Bildeinbindung sein, würde ich sagen. Sonst hat man durch nur die Breitenbeschränkung ein Problem bei sehr schmalen Bildern. (Wobei die wohl keine Stadt hat...hmm) ✓ Done (restricted size to 30x30px)
  • adding arrows for next/before years/decades/centuries ✓ Done
  • (low prio) bei den Prä- und Suffixen sollte das Leerzeichen mit im Suffix drin sein und nicht fest im Code. Vielleicht wird in manchen Sprachen kein Leerzeichen zwischen Jahr in Suffix/Präfix verwendet. Aber: Man kann in einem Parameter kein führendes Leerzeichen reinpacken...
Hat sich wohl erledigt. Wohl keine leichte Möglichkeit da, um das mit dem Leerzeichen zu machen, außer, wenn man nur drei zusätzliche Parameter einführt, die angeben, dass kein Leerzeichen verwendet werden soll. Jene könnte man dann aber, falls sie gebraucht würden auch noch nachträglich einbauen. Beim Standardfall (mit Leerzeichen) wären sie dann halt einfach nicht gesetzt. beim Englischen scheint alles mit Leerzeichen zu sein.
  • Implementing categories, so that they do not need to type manually (a switch for century/decade/year is necessary, whatever the category is).